The measure of angle RQS is 50°.

Solution:

Given data:

m(ar QTS) = 260°

<u>Tangent-chord theorem:</u>

<em>If a tangent and chord intersect at a point, then the measure of each angle formed is half of the measure of its intercepted arc.</em>

$ m \angle PQS  = \frac{1}{2}\times m(ar \ QTS)

              $  = \frac{1}{2}\times260^\circ

              =130^\circ

m∠PQS = 130°

<em>Sum of the adjacent angles in a straight line is 180°.</em>

m∠PQS + m∠RQS = 180°

130° + m∠RQS = 180°

Subtract 130° from both sides.

130° + m∠RQS - 130° = 180° - 130°

m∠RQS = 50°

The measure of angle RQS is 50°.

Mrs.Traynor's class is taking a field trip to the zoo. The trip will cost $26 for each student. There are 22 students in her cla
iren [92.7K]
Well, estimate means to get like a general idea, or "in the ball park".
The factors include; the trip which is $26, and the ammount of students in the class, which is 22.
In order to estimate, you need to round.
$26 rounded becomes $30.
22 rounded becomes 20.
So now that we have the rounded numbers, we solve the problem. In order to find the total cost for all the students, we multiply the amount of students, by the ammount of money it costs per student.
The estimated version of this is: 20x30=600
This means that the estimated answer is $600 total.
Now do the same thing with the actual numbers.
22x26=572.
This means that the actual answer is $572.
